We are preparing to disembark our cruise on Meraviglia today.  We have had a very interesting cruise and onboard experience. 

Regarding our experience with Voyagers Club on board, not so good.

-Never received invitation for Welcome Aboard cocktail party and complementary  onboard photo.

-Never received chocolate ships.

We were not able to attend Black Party as I was busy trying to straighten out our travel arrangements. Went up 40 minutes late, and clean up was all that was happening.  Thinking that ships might show up after dinner, not.  Perhaps in the morning??  No.   

 

-Received invite for Black Party morning of day of and same for Free Dance Class. This was last day of cruise.

-Card for Speciality Dinner-  arrived in Cabin on day 5 of 7 day cruise. 

 

Went down to desk this morning to inquire. Wa told she would be there at 10:30 am.  Came back around 10:40, and was told she would not actuallly be available until 4pm.  We are disembarking at 2pm so , no luck getting our missing items.

Oh well.

This is not "The Current State of The Voyagers Club"  but rather a reflection of the Ineptitude of a particular Voyagers' Club Rep.

The rep is responsible for organizing ALL the events listed above. They are also the future cruise consultant and as such are very highly paid.

 

I suggest that you and should contact MSC and complain about the said consultant and point out they are doing MSC a great deal of customer dissatisfaction

Sorry to hear this , good to hear you enjoyed YC. 

Our first experience of Black card status Match was wonderful 2 years ago, the Prosecco and chocolate dipped fruit  were in the cabin on embarkation. The invitations to the various events came through quickly .

Since then things have gone down hill due to the numbers now of Black card Voyager club members. On Seaview we did not receive the Prosecco til the penultimate night, excuse was the ship is so big they only deliver now on one day  to all Black card members , fair enough . I did comment that it felt like a “ sad to see you go” bottle of Prosecco rather than a “ welcome aboard “ 😆.

We received an e.mail from MSC before our last cruise listing all our  benefits and are now experienced enough to know what we should be getting . 

Skier is right, it is the responsibility of the rep onboard to make sure everything is done in a timely manner.
